Company Overview

Kairos Power is a new nuclear energy technology and engineering company whose mission is to enable the world’s transition to clean energy, with the ultimate goal to dramatically improve people’s quality of life while protecting the environment. This goal will be accomplished through the commercialization of the fluoride-salt-cooled, high-temperature reactor (FHR) that can be deployed with robust safety, affordable costs, and flexible operation to accommodate the expansion of variable renewables.

Job Summary  

The Reactor Vessel System team is seeking a highly motivated Senior Engineer to join the growing Reactor Systems department. In this role, you will have the opportunity to work directly on the design, analysis, integration, fabrication, and deployment of reactor vessel structures, systems, and components for a first-of-a-kind fluoride-salt-cooled, high-temperature reactor. 

Reporting directly to the Head of Reactor Systems, the position will support the development of reactor vessel hardware and interfaces, including the vessel shell, penetrations, supports, closures, structural interfaces, and related mechanical components. This position requires a strong aptitude for mechanical design, systems engineering, high-temperature structural design, engineering analysis, and component lifecycle management. The role will regularly interface with multidisciplinary teams including, nuclear design, thermal hydraulics, fuels and materials, safety analysis, remote handling, manufacturing, quality, plant design integration, and instrumentation and controls. 

You will work closely with adjacent reactor system teams to mature reactor vessel design requirements, resolve technical and spatial interfaces, support design trades, and deliver hardware that meets safety, performance, manufacturability, inspection, and maintainability objectives.

Note: You are applying for a position that is located in a facility that handles information that is subject to export control restrictions by the Department of Energy under 10 CFR Part 810. To work in this facility, you need to be authorized by the Department of Energy to access Part 810-controlled information. Foreign nationals who are citizens of countries that are not on the Department of Energy’s general authorization list (link below) are not permitted to work in our facility unless the Department of Energy issues an export control license to the company to permit that individual to have access to Part 810-controlled information.
